SIMS v. WESTERN STEEL CO.

Nos. 75-1849 and 76-1703.

551 F.2d 811 (1977)

Royal W. SIMS and the R. W. Sims Trust, Plaintiffs-Appellees, v. WESTERN STEEL COMPANY, Defendant-Appellant.

United States Court of Appeals, Tenth Circuit.

Decided March 25, 1977.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John A. Young, Fort Wayne, Ind. (Robert D. Maack, Watkiss & Campbell, Salt Lake City, Utah, on the brief), for plaintiffs-appellees.

George M. McMillan, McMillan & Browning, Salt Lake City, Utah (Ted Boyer, McMillan & Browning, Salt Lake City, Utah, on the brief), for defendant-appellant.

Before McWILLIAMS, BARRETT and DOYLE, Circuit Judges.


WILLIAM E. DOYLE, Circuit Judge.

Defendant-appellant seeks reversal of judgments entered by the United States District Court for the District of Utah on September 23, 1975, and on May 28, 1976. In the first of these partial summary judgment was entered growing out of the alleged breach of license agreement executed in 1968 by plaintiff-appellee, Sims, and defendant-appellant, Western Steel Company.
